  • &TV’s The Voice India Kids gears up for Battles

    &TV’s The Voice India Kids gears up for Battles

    Mumbai: &TV’s premiere singing reality show The Voice India Kids has gained immense popularity and fan following for its great talent, fun banter between the Coaches and superlative singing. The young voices introduced in BLIND audition have definitely lived up to the motto of “Size kum hai, par dum nahi” with the youngest contestant being all of 6 years old! The Coaches – Shekhar, Neeti and Shaan have fought for the Voices that struck a chord with them and have now formed their teams with the best contestants. With 18 contestants in each team, the race to the finish has only intensified further! Don’t miss the unique, spellbinding and high voltage episodes of the fiery BATTLES starting August 27th every Saturday and Sunday at 9:00 pm only on &TV.

    If you thought the BLIND audition was unique, the BATTLES will be even more impactful. Each coach will choose 3 kids from their own team and train them for a song that highlights their best aspect of singing. The coaches will be seen leaving no stone unturned to spend time with their teams and imparting knowledge about music. However, during the BATTLES, the coaches will find themselves in a tight spot as they will take a call and eliminate 2 contestants from the trio they formed themselves. To add to this metaphorical round is the set design wherein the stage will be set up like a boxing ring.

    Interestingly, for the BATTLES, the coaches have sought help from the best in the industry. While Singer Harshdeep Kaur joined Neeti to sort trios and pick songs for them, Music Director Shantanu Moitra backed Shaan and engaged in the selection process of his team. Composer, Musician, Singer and Lyricist Amit Trivedi spent time with Shekhar and his team and tried various combination of voices till they found the perfect trio.

  • ‘Neerja:’ The heroine of the hijack!

    ‘Neerja:’ The heroine of the hijack!

    Neerja, the film, is a biographical account of the PanAm air hostess, Neerja Bhanot. However, the disclaimer at the beginning of the film says it is not exactly so. To make this film would be a tricky challenge since Neerja’s image has become larger than life and her acts of valour have become part of legend.

    Neerja sacrificed her life to save hundreds of other in the course of duty and she has since been decorated posthumously by India’s highest gallantry award, the Ashok Chakra, besides the Philatelic Department issuing a postage stamp in her honour. Neerja was also awarded by the Pakistan government and the US Justice Department. 

    Neerja, played by Sonam Kapoor, was a daughter of the Bhanots, Harish and Rama, desperately wanted despite already having two sons. Her parents always imbibed the virtues of courage in their daughter, pampered equally by the parents as well as brothers. 

    Neerja is married off in an arranged match and moves with her husband to the Gulf. However, the teachings did not help Neerja in this personal battle when her husband started ill-treating and taunting her for not brining dowry and also for her modelling. The marriage failed and she returned to be with her parents in Mumbai. 

    Neerja then applied for a job with the American airliner, PanAm and was selected and later trained at Miami. She now has overcome the setback in her marriage, has a job, modelling assignments as well as a friend, Shekhar Ravjiani, who is keen to marry her. 

    Neerja was on her first flight as a chief purser on a Mumbai-Frankfurt-New York flight. But, the plane makes an unscheduled stop at Karachi. Here, four Libyan terrorists, dressed in Pakistani security uniforms board the plane. Neerja senses trouble immediately and alerts the flying crew of three who escape from an overhead hatch in the cabin. This was so that the terrorists could not compel them to fly wherever they wished. 

    What followed is what made Neerja a legend and earned her the title of ‘The heroine of the hijack.’ As the senior-most crew member on the flight, she takes charge, pacifies the passengers, communicates with the terrorists and goes on doing all she can to save the situation. 

    The terrorists want the Pakistani authorities to find replacement pilots to fly out. As the hours pass, they want to set an example and kill passengers one by one. Their anger is on the Americans and ask Neerja and other hostesses to collect the passports of all the American passengers on board to identify and kill them to pressurise the Pakistanis. But, Neerja orders her subordinates not to collect American passports. Instead hide them under the seats or get rid of them through the rubbish chute.

    The standoff lasts for over 17 hours when the aircraft battery life ends and the lights go off. The terrorists become frantic and, in desperation, start shooting blindly and chuck grenades in the plane. Neerja acts and opens the door as well as the emergency escape chute. Having done that, she could have been the first one to escape. Having helped all the passengers escape, it is when she is trying to help three unaccompanied children escape, that a terrorist shoots her.

    Director Ram Madhvani has done a competent job ably helped by screenplay writer, Saiwyn Quadras, who has done well to merge Neerja’s marital troubles flashbacks with the hijack scenes. Hijack and terrorism scenes may have been seen many times but the human angle here gives the film much credence. The last part where Neerja opens the aircraft door and lowers the chute is the essence of the film and has solid emotional impact. 

    For Sonam, getting into Neerja’s shoes is a tough task but she manages to get into the skin of the character as the film progresses. Shabana Azmi, Shekhar and Yogendra Tiku have brief parts but are convincing. Terrorists are sinister enough to make an impact.

    Neerja has had a varied opening response at the box office but word of mouth is encouraging. It is such a film that needs to work.

    ‘Direct Ishq:’ Also ran

    Benaras has been attracting some filmmakers and writers to weave their stories in this holy city. It is not because of their love for the city or because of any religious leanings. When you want to pit a simple middle class girl against a gun-toting hero juxtaposed with another boy from the same city and similar background having made it big with hard work and honesty, you need a state with a reputation for lawlessness. Therefore it is not surprising that many such films are based in one such Hindi belt locale.

    Direct Ishq is a love triangle in the traditional mode where two guys, a good one and a bad one, fall in love with same girl. The boys in this case are Rajneesh Duggal and Arjun Bijlani, while the girl is Nidhi Subbaiah.

    Nidhi is a pretty and popular girl for the way she conducts herself, full of pep. But she knows her limits and keeps away from any sort of trouble from boys who try to woo her. Rajeev is a local college boy and the leader of the university students’ body. He believes that power comes from being tough. He is always ready to pick a fight and adds to his muscle by being armed with a gun. He is besotted with Nidhi but when it comes to girls, he is tongue tied. He can never make himself gather enough courage to tell her his feelings. 

    Rajneesh enters the scene to complete the triangle. He is another Benaras lad who has got his education in Mumbai and now has his own event management company there. Nidhi is an aspiring singer who wants to make a name for herself and make her family proud. In this event, Rajneesh would be the right person to fulfil her aspirations. While helping her cause, he also falls in love with her.

    The film provides scope for music as well as Benaras kind of action scenes. While nothing is new here, it being a musical also does not count for much as of innumerable songs, just a couple pass muster. Action is routine. 

    Direct Ishq is another also ran.

  • Shah Rukh debutes with Shekhar Ravjiani for a Marathi musical

    Shah Rukh debutes with Shekhar Ravjiani for a Marathi musical

    MUMBAI: Venturing into a new foray Bollywood‘s Baadshah Shah Rukh Khan (SRK) is about to make a musical debut in the regional language space with a Marathi movie. It is confirmed that SRK will shoot for a song with the music composer and singer Shekhar Ravjiani. Apparently it didn‘t take a lot of convincing for Ravjiani for his music single, Saanvlias the proceeds from this song will be donated to an NGO.

    Saanvli will also feature Sunidhi Chauhan and the songs refreshes the concept of first love which is why SRK has been roped in since he is synonymous with romance.

    A source from the industry revealed “Shekhar met him (SRK) at a studio and played out the single for him. He connected with the song instantly and agreed to feature in the video.”

    The music video has been directed by Ravi Jadhav (who has won a National Award forNatrang) and the lyrics are written by Amitabh Bhattacharya. The song video will feature Shah Rukh reciting the verse that reads ‘Parchhayi Teri Saanvli SiNatkhat Thodi Baavli Si‘.

    When contacted, Shekhar who is also one of the judges for Indian Idol Junior confirmed the story and said, “His thoughtfulness and love has made this video very special to me.” Shekhari‘s credibility in the regional language was much appreciated last year in his album Saazni.
